In a large bowl, combine the flour and salt. Make a well in the center and add the eggs and warm water.
Mix the ingredients with a fork until you have a crumbly dough. Turn it onto a floured surface and knead for about 5 minutes until smooth and elastic. Cover the dough with a damp cloth and let it rest for 20 minutes.
In a pan,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and garlic, and sauté until translucent.
In a large bowl, combine the cooked onion and garlic with ground chicken, spinach, parsley, black pepper, and nutmeg. Mix well to combine.
Divide the dough into two portions. Roll out each portion on a floured surface to a thin sheet.
Cut the dough sheets into rectangles, approximately 10cm x 15cm in size.
Place a tablespoon of the chicken and spinach filling onto each rectangle. Fold the dough over the filling and press the edges to seal, creating a pocket.
Bring the chicken broth to a simmer in a large pot.
Gently add the Maultaschen to the simmering broth and cook for about 10-12 minutes until they float to the surface and are cooked through.
Remove from the broth and serve hot, optionally garnished with fresh parsley.
